: A combined "Apple II Everything FAQ" (hey, cool name! ;-)) will
:quickly get out of hand, IMHO. For example, I would like to see Larry
:Virden's "Apple II Programmer's Catalog" incorporated (perhaps in
:abbreviated form) into the csa2.programmer FAQ.
I would rather NOT see it incorporated. What I would rather see is for
the FAQs to go the way the rest of the world goes, rather than dragging
along remaining in the 70s and 80s. That is to say, use Uniform Resource
Locator ids within the FAQs to point to valuable resources. Then folks
who have the ability to browse the FAQs as live documents are able to
hypertext through the documents, finding information along the way
whereever it is found.
Perhaps someday, if the GS and IIe ever are brought into the TCP world,
we will even have a hypertext WorldWideWeb client which would let us
browse the documents from home - now THAT'S _my_ dream.
If you have access to a box with direct internet access, pop over to
comp.infosystems.www and find one of the several clients which work on
your system and check out the web. Check out the hypertext FAQs that
are being generated automatically at Ohio State. That's the direction
that the Apple 2 FAQs should go - readable in plain text, but ALSO live
for those who can use them.
